Transaction 2ec64c282f605cb4700416665e4e5da6fe0ff3f6def9cf136989f810a60af91f
1 Input
1 Output
-
2ec64c282f605cb4700416665e4e5da6fe0ff3f6def9cf136989f810a60af91f:0
- value
- 643796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d401243ed72ac0baa5560765e96f0250892ee77 OP_EQUAL
- address
- 3LQHCdAcEcEHg1U1axUzqkTx9Q3Mohu6qn